“Vast majority” of Xbox One owners uses Kinect according to Microsoft

The movement tracking device that started its humble journey back in the days of Xbox 360 hadn’t been received all that well, especially after the early plans for it with the Xbox One and the mandatory inclusion which raised the price for the whole unit. However, you’ll be surprised that according to Microsoft the vast majority of Xbox One owners have used a Kinect.

Speaking to an interview, Microsoft’s Chief Marketing Officer at Xbox Mike Nichols talked a little about the peripheral saying that without going into numbers, a lot of people use their Kinect for various tasks outside gaming.

“When the team was launching we assumed 100 percent ownership and use of the Kinect. There was a simplification from a design perspective. There was a simplification from a design perspective. Now we’re not designing for everyone who has it or everyone doesn’t have it. We’re designing for a good chunk who have it and use it and some new customers who now have decided to get an Xbox One who don’t have a Kinect, at least not yet.”

Xbox One is now available without Kinect for $350 currently through many offers, as well as an upcoming 1TB model that will be soon released.
